CVE-2026-7253
IBM Watson Speech Services Cartridge is vulnerable to Server-Side Request Forgery (SSRF) in Sterling File Gateway
Description

IBM Watson Speech Services Cartridge is vulnerable to Server-Side Request Forgery (SSRF) in Sterling File Gateway, due to a flaw which may allow an authenticated attacker to send unauthorized requests from the system, potentially leading to network enumeration or facilitating other attacks [GHSA-rr7j-v2q5-chgv] [CVE-2026-7253]. IBM Sterling File Gateway is used in our speech runtimes. This vulnerabilitiy has been addressed. Please read the details for remediation below.

Solution
Apply the security update for IBM Watson Speech Services Cartridge to fix the SSRF vulnerability.
  • Apply the vendor-provided security update.
  • Review system configurations for unauthorized changes.
  • Monitor network traffic for suspicious activity.
